Coco Gauff is an American professional tennis player. She has been ranked at world No. 2 in singles, and world No. 1 in doubles, by the Women’s Tennis Association (WTA). In singles, her wins include two majors at the 2023 US Open and 2025 French Open, and the 2024 WTA Finals. In doubles, her wins include the 2024 French Open, with Kateřina Siniaková.
She is the daughter of Candi, a college track-and-field athlete, and educator, and Corey Gauff, who played college basketball, and is a health care executive. Coco was partly raised in Delray Beach, Florida, where she trained in tennis. She is a Christian.
Coco is sometimes described as having Haitian ancestry. Both of her parents are of African-American lineage, with deep American roots. If she has Haitian ancestry, it is distant.
Coco’s paternal grandfather is Milton Joseph Gauff (the son of Valsin Adam Gauff and Myrtle Gabriel). Milton was born in Louisiana. Valsin was born in Reserve, St. John the Baptist, Louisiana, the son of Felix Gauff and Alice Shilo/Shiloh/Charlot/Charlo. Myrtle was born in Louisiana, the daughter of Alma Hayden. Alma’s great-grandfather, Green Slaughter, fought with the U.S. Colored Infantry in the Civil War.
Coco’s paternal grandmother is Deborah Jean Wright (the daughter of Clifford Preston Wright and Lucille Hunter). Clifford was born in Tarrytown, Montgomery, Georgia, the son of Samuel Wright, or “Buster,” and of Celeste, or “Peaches.” Lucille was born in South Carolina, the daughter of Daniel Hunter and Alice Wallace.
Coco’s maternal grandfather is Eddie “Red” Odom Jr. (the son of Eddie D. Odom and Essie Mae Brown). Coco’s grandfather Eddie was born in Quitman, Brooks, Georgia, and was a professional baseball player, in the minor leagues. He played for the Delray All‑Stars. Coco’s great-grandfather Eddie was born in Ashburn, Turner, Georgia, the son of John Odom and Fannie Collins. Coco’s great-grandmother Essie was born in Georgia, the daughter of July Brown and Bessie L. Watts. July’s father, Handy Brown, fought in the Civil War with the U.S. Colored Troops.
Coco’s maternal grandmother is Yvonne/Evon Bernedette Lee (the daughter of The Rev. Randolph Melvin Lee and Mattie Lou Williams). Yvonne was born in Florida. Randolph was born in White Springs, Hamilton, Florida, the son of Robert Henry Lee and Ada Tillman. Mattie was born in Georgia.
